Runbook: GarageGlance occupancy feed

If the Harborview Deck occupancy feed goes stale (no updates for 5+ minutes), first check the sensor gateway health page. Green but stale usually means the aggregator queue is backed up; restart the aggregator via the ops console and counts should recover within two minutes. If spots show negative numbers, force a full recount from the camera snapshots. When escalating to engineering, include the trace token shown below.

session token of yawif-kahof = htk9_dd6996ed6

All timestamps are stored internally as UTC; the export layer converts to the tenant's configured zone at render time, not at query time. Your plugin must never apply its own offset, or rows near midnight will shift across date boundaries. Daylight-saving transitions are handled by the core formatter, which also disambiguates repeated hours. Test against the Marrowfield sample tenant before submitting. The complete conversion reference lives at the internal page below.

operations page: https://jenkins.zemvarcloud.local/job/merge_requests/repo/build/73930b4b30f0a8ed

The orphaned-resource sweeper now runs every two hours instead of daily, and the grace period before a resource is considered orphaned dropped from 72 to 24 hours. Dry-run mode is no longer the default; deletions are real unless explicitly disabled. On-call should expect more frequent sweep notifications and a one-time spike of deletions after the upgrade. Resources tagged for retention are still exempt, and every deletion is logged with a restore window. The new default configuration is:

service settings:
PRAIX_LOG_LEVEL=error
PRAIX_METRICS_HOST=metrics.praix.qorvelcorp.corp
PRAIX_POOL_SIZE=16

## Ownership: Date Localization

Quick note for release prep: all date formatting in Shipwright now flows through the LocaleLens module, so don't hardcode formats anywhere — regional builds (Vendria, Kostova, and the Marn Islands) each get their own pattern files. If a locale looks wrong in a release candidate, file it against the i18n board. The module owner who approves locale changes is listed below.

account owner for bawip-tahag: Raleth Quenok